How to Dress a Dog Like the Easter Bunny

Everyone loves to do something special for Easter. Most celebrate both the Christian aspect and the later created symbol, the Easter Bunny. If your family has a big celebration for Easter, you can also get your pet involved. It's relatively easy to dress a dog like an Easter Bunny. Getting the dog to stay dressed is the trick.

Difficulty: Moderately Easy
Instructions
  1. Step 1

    Buy fuzzy pink ears with white on the inside front. If you cannot find them in the store, then create them yourself.

  2. Step 2

    Create the ears by cutting 2 elongated ovals out of fuzzy pink materials. Cut two smaller ones out of white.

  3. Step 3

    Snip off one end and stitch a white and pink ear together with the right sides facing each other. Turn the ears right side out.

  4. Step 4

    Shape a thin coated wire into the shape of the ears of a bunny and insert the wire into the newly created cloth ears. The wire gives them extra stability.

  5. Step 5

    Stitch right next to the wire on the inside of the wire. The stitching should be right next to the wire on the inside of the ear.

  6. Step 6

    Create a pink cloth band that's long enough to go around your dog's neck with additional material to tie it. Cut two pieces of material 1 1/2 inches wide and stitch them together with the right sides facing. Leave one end open to turn right side out. Wrap the base of the ears under the band, making certain to center it properly. Fold back the base on top and stitch through the three layers. This will be at the back of the band.

  7. Step 7

    Get a fluffy pink dog jacket or sweater. Glue a white cotton tail to the back middle of the sweater. Dress your dog and quickly take a picture.
